Russian Sergey Makov, Former World Record Holder, Suspended For Two Years
Russian Sergey Makov has been handed a two-year suspension dating back to the 2013 Moscow stop of the FINA World Cup series.

Egypt dominates Arab Championships led by distance sweeps from youngsters
Egypt rolled through the 2nd Arab Championships earlier this month, winning 33 of 42 events, including distance sweeps by 19-year-old Marwan Ahmed Aly Morsy and 16-year-old Roaia Mohamed Ahmed.
